The year started with a bang at New Year's Revolution in January. Edge shocked the world by cashing in the first-ever Money in the Bank briefcase on a bloodied John Cena to win his first WWE Championship. This moment fundamentally changed the landscape of WWE, establishing the "Ultimate Opportunist" as a top-tier main event heel and sparking a bitter, year-long feud with Cena.

By 2006, WWE had firmly settled into the brand extension era. Raw and SmackDown! operated as largely separate rosters, each with its own championships, storylines, and pay-per-view events. The “Ruthless Aggression” era—which had begun in 2002—was now in full swing, and Raw was the undisputed flagship show on the USA Network. You can find full 2006 episodes on Netflix
